Transaction d10110962c46262679839e32296a32a23ea7eb3c8162f30698d53ac03b37e74c
1 Input
1 Output
-
d10110962c46262679839e32296a32a23ea7eb3c8162f30698d53ac03b37e74c:0
- value
- 423914848
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ff9796877dbcfb6c939f20d3de5ea051a2c868ed
- address
- bc1ql7tedpmahnakeyulyrfauh4q2x3vs68d0xwwxu